McClure Motors


Comment on this owner


NASCAR Cup

NASCAR Cup results by track | NASCAR Cup results by driver

YearStartsPolesWinsTop 5sTop 10sAvg. StartAvg. FinishX LedLaps LedLaps
19774000027.250018.5000001329
19784000128.500017.5000001009
19793000030.000028.666700425
Total11000128.454520.9091002763


comments powered by Disqus